Checklist: template rendering perf — Quillcast

Before we cut the release, someone needs to run the render benchmark against the Harborview template set and compare against last week's numbers. We're looking for no more than a 5% regression on cold-cache renders; warm-cache should be flat. If partial caching got touched this sprint (looking at you, layout team), double the sample size. Drop results in the sync notes so we can eyeball them together. The benchmarked build's trace token goes right below this line.

pipeline stamp: htk6_7941f2

## Aurelo Plus — Manager Brief (Restricted)

Heads up, sales leads: we're launching a new subscription tier, Aurelo Plus, next quarter. It sits between Core and Enterprise, bundling priority support and the Glimmerbox analytics add-on. Pricing isn't public yet, so keep it off calls for now. Migration playbooks land in two weeks. The strategic reasoning sits in the confidential note below.

board note of kageg-bahof: The renewal with Holwynax Holdings closes at $2 million a year, 5 percent below the last contract. Project Ulaath slips by two quarters because of the supplier delay.

For this week's sync, a refresher on how Ferrowatt devices receive firmware. Every unit subscribes to one of three channels — stable, canary, or bench — managed by the Updraft service. New engineers should note that channel assignment is immutable after provisioning, so test devices must be enrolled on bench from the start. To run Updraft locally, copy the template env, set FW_CHANNEL=bench and UPDRAFT_REGION to your lab's code, and verify the manifest URL resolves. Then add the package signing secret on the line immediately after.

sealed setting: ARCHIVE_KEY3=8d0